Darren Glenn Austin, a prolific inventor based in Seattle, WA, has made significant contributions in the field of technology with his three patented innovations. His latest patents showcase his expertise in web-based collaboration workspaces and distributed managed communications functionality via multiple mobile devices.
One of Darren's recent patents is for a "Web-based Embeddable Collaborative Workspace." This invention addresses the need for freeform input in various application or document types, particularly in collaboration settings. The patent describes a system that enables the insertion of an electronic collaboration workspace capable of accepting and storing freeform input. This workspace can be embedded in different documents, providing users with a versatile tool for collaboration. Multiple users can access and reference the stored input, further enhancing the collaborative experience.
Another one of Darren's patents focuses on providing "Distributed Managed Communications Functionality via Multiple Mobile Devices." This patent introduces techniques for coordinating the inter-connection of multiple mobile devices of various types. The invention includes matchmaking operations to determine how these inter-connected devices can provide functionality to each other or access functionality from remote server computing systems. Additionally, it introduces the concept of a distributed display canvas, where the displays of inter-connected mobile devices collectively display a graphical user interface (GUI) of an application. This innovation opens up new possibilities for seamless collaboration and interaction across mobile devices.
